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Logic Pro
- Requires macOS 15.6 or later and a Mac with Apple silicon, so it will not run on an Intel Mac or on Windows at all
- On iPad it is not available as a one-time purchase, only through Apple Creator Studio at $12.99/month or $129/year
- The iPad version requires iPadOS 26 or later and an iPad with an A12 Bionic chip or later
- The standalone Mac app is $199.99, paid before any evaluation beyond the 30 day Apple Creator Studio trial
Serato DJ
- Whether the software is free depends on which specific controller model you own, so buying hardware without checking its unlock status can mean an unexpected licence fee.
- DVS support, which many working DJs need, sits in the Suite tier rather than the base Pro tier, adding real cost for vinyl-style control.
- Serato DJ Lite deliberately withholds features present in Pro, so a DJ testing on Lite cannot fully evaluate what the paid tiers offer.
- The subscription and one-time purchase prices are not simply related; a DJ paying monthly for years can end up paying more than the outright purchase price without a clear point where switching makes sense.
- Cross-brand hardware support depends on manufacturer licensing deals with Serato, so a DJ switching to an unsupported or newly released controller may lose the free unlock entirely.

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Logic Pro: How much does Logic Pro cost?
Logic Pro is available through Apple Creator Studio at $12.99/month or $129/year (annual subscription saves $25.88 versus monthly). Alternatively, Logic Pro for Mac can be purchased as a one-time $199.99 standalone license on the App Store. Students and educators receive discounted pricing at $2.99/month or $29.99/year.
SourceSerato DJ: Do I need to pay for Serato if I already own a DJ controller?
It depends on the model. Many mainstream controllers ship with Serato DJ Pro pre-unlocked; others require a separate Pro or Suite purchase or subscription.
Logic Pro: Does Logic Pro offer a free trial?
Yes, Apple Creator Studio (which includes Logic Pro) offers a 30-day free trial, allowing users to test all bundled apps including Final Cut Pro, Motion, and Compressor before committing to payment.
SourceSerato DJ: What is the difference between Lite and Pro?
Lite is free but feature-reduced; Pro adds the full mixing feature set and is either a $299 one-time purchase or an $11.99 monthly subscription.
Logic Pro: What is the difference between Logic Pro subscription and one-time purchase?
The Apple Creator Studio subscription at $12.99/month includes Logic Pro for Mac and iPad plus Final Cut Pro, Motion, Compressor, and other apps. The $199.99 one-time purchase for Logic Pro for Mac standalone provides only Logic Pro without bundled applications.
SourceSerato DJ: Does DVS vinyl control cost extra?
Yes, DVS is part of the Suite tier, not the base Pro tier, unless it comes bundled through specific hardware promotions.
